Failure to follow Instructions
could result in serious injury or
death_ The safety alert symbol
is used to identify safety inform-
ation about hazards which can
result tn death, serious injury
and/or property damage.
DANGER Indicates a hazard which, if not avotded,
will result In death or serious Injury,
WARNING indicatesa hazard whtch, If not avoided,
could result In death or serious Injury.
CAUTION indicates a hazard which, ifnot avoided,
might result In minor or moderate Injury.
CAUTION when used without the alert symbol,
Indicates a situation that could result in damage
to the tractor and/or engine.
HOT SURFACES indicatesa hazard which,
ifnot avoided, could result In death, serious injury
and/or property damage.
FIRE indicatesa hazardwhich,if not avoided,
could result In death, serious Injury and/or
property damage.
